How Flood Water Extraction Works

When you call our team for flood water extraction, we’ll dispatch a crew of experienced technicians who will arrive quickly to assess the situation.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water from your property, including submersible pumps and wet/dry vacuums. Our technicians will then dry your property and belongings using commercial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technicians will assess the extent of the damage and create a customized plan to extract water from your property. This may involve removing wet drywall, flooring, and other materials to prevent further damage. We’ll also identify areas that need specialized drying equipment, such as crawl spaces and attics.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our technicians will use submersible pumps and wet/dry vacuums to extract water from your property, including standing water, saturated carpets, and damaged materials. We’ll work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your property back to normal as soon as possible.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, our technicians will use commercial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ry your property and belongings. We’ll monitor the moisture levels in your property to ensure that everything is dry and free of moisture.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

Our technicians will use specialized equipment to sanitize and disinfect your property, including surfaces, carpets, and upholstery. This will help prevent the growth of mold and mildew, which can cause health problems and further damage to your property.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up

Once the drying and sanitizing process is complete, our technicians will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your property is dry and free of moisture. We’ll also clean up any debris or materials that were removed during the extraction process.

Flood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 100 square feet) Yes No You can likely handle a small water spill on your own with a wet/dry vacuum and some towels.
Large water spill (over 100 square feet) No Yes A large water spill needs specialized equipment and expertise to extract water efficiently and prevent further damage.
Standing water in crawl space or attic No Yes Standing water in crawl spaces or attics needs specialized equipment and expertise to extract water safely and prevent further damage.
Water damage to structural elements (e.g., walls, floors) No Yes Water damage to structural elements needs prompt attention from a professional to prevent further damage and collapse.
Visible mold or mildew growth No Yes Visible mold or mildew growth needs prompt attention from a professional to prevent health problems and further damage.
Water damage to electrical systems or appliances No Yes Water damage to electrical systems or appliances needs prompt attention from a professional to prevent electrical shock or further damage.

Flood Water Extraction Cost in Copiague, NY

The cost of flood water extraction in Copiague, NY, can vary depending on the severity and extent of the damage, as well as the size of the affected area. Our team will provide a customized estimate based on your specific needs and circumstances.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ction (less than 100 square feet) $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of materials affected
Water extraction (100-500 square feet) $2,500 – $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of materials affected
Water extraction (over 500 square feet) $10,000 – $50,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of materials affected
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of materials affected
Sanitizing and dis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of materials affected
Final inspection and cleanup $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of materials affected
